Transient being sought for stabbing a 18 year old and injuring her sister has prior record of robbery, drugs, battery and more





Police are still looking for a man suspected of fatally stabbing an 18-year-old Nia Wilson  and injuring her 26-year-old sister Lahtifa Wilson last night at the MacArthur BART station in Oakland.

"In May 2016, Cowell was convicted of felony second-degree robbery charges, according to court records. That same year a Kaiser Hospital in Richmond filed a restraining order against him after he repeatedly harassed and threatened staff members with physical harm."

"A separate restraining order was filed against Cowell in 2015, but the circumstances were not immediately available."

"Cowell was previously convicted of battery in June 2013, and of being under the influence of a controlled substance in March 2016. Both those incidents happened in Walnut Creek."

"He also had several misdemeanor infractions of vandalism, petty theft and possession of a controlled substance on his record, according to Alameda County court records."
